As nouns,
jiffy
is a hyponym of
mo
; that is,
jiffy
is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than
mo
:
mo
: an indefinitely short time
jiffy
: a very short time (as the time it takes the eye to blink or the heart to beat)
Other hyponyms of mo include
blink of an eye
,
flash
,
heartbeat
,
instant
,
New York minute
,
split second
,
trice
,
twinkling
,
wink
.
